Output d7b321150f6fa394734d1d29d4f80213400e361e84be69a35e53a637eb1ea6c4:19

value
20687302
script pubkey
OP_0 OP_PUSHBYTES_20 66aa57d0ff24691e3cfaf779bd3549d2484c1ba4
address
ltc1qv649058ly353u0867aum6d2f6fyycxaycp8ujm
transaction
d7b321150f6fa394734d1d29d4f80213400e361e84be69a35e53a637eb1ea6c4
spent
true